#dc614f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c614f is composed of 86.3% red, 38%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.9% magenta, 64.1%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 7.7 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 58.6%. #dc614f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c29e with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

● #dc614f color description : Soft red.
#dc614f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c614f has RGB values of R:220, G:97,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.64,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14442831.

Shades and Tints of #dc614f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c614f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9190 is the less saturated color, while #fc492f is the most saturated one.
